Best Places to See in Winters – November in Himachal Pradesh and Uttarakhand

Estimated reading time: 3 minutes

Winter, with its enchanting chill and captivating landscapes, unveils a different charm in the northern regions of India, specifically in Himachal Pradesh and Uttarakhand. As the temperature drops, these picturesque destinations transform into a winter wonderland, offering a mesmerizing experience for those seeking a unique blend of tranquility and adventure.

Embracing the Serenity: Himachal Pradesh’s Winter Marvels

Shimla: A Snow-Kissed Paradise

Nestled in the heart of the Himalayas, Shimla stands as an epitome of winter allure. The historic Ridge, adorned with colonial architecture, transforms into a snowy spectacle, providing an ideal backdrop for leisurely strolls. The Jakhu Temple, perched atop Jakhu Hill, offers panoramic views of the snow-clad landscape, creating a serene ambiance for spiritual seekers and nature enthusiasts alike.

Manali: Where Winter Whispers in Every Gust

Manali, with its ethereal beauty, is a winter haven that captivates the soul. Rohtang Pass, blanketed in snow, becomes accessible, offering a thrilling experience for adventure seekers. The Solang Valley, embraced by snow-laden peaks, becomes a playground for winter sports enthusiasts. Manali is not just a destination; it’s a canvas painted with the pure white strokes of winter magic.

Dharamshala: Winter Tranquility in the Lap of the Dhauladhar Range

Known for its Tibetan influence and the residence of the Dalai Lama, Dharamshala transforms into a serene retreat during winters. The Bhagsu Waterfall, partially frozen, adds a mystical touch to the landscape. The McLeod Ganj market, adorned with colorful Tibetan prayer flags, offers a unique shopping experience amidst the winter breeze.

Uttarakhand’s Winter Symphony

Mussoorie: Winter Elegance in the Queen of Hills

Mussoorie, often referred to as the Queen of Hills, dons a winter cloak that enhances its charm manifold. The Camel’s Back Road, lined with deodar trees, becomes a tranquil pathway for nature enthusiasts. Kempty Falls, partially frozen, exude a serene beauty, inviting visitors to witness nature’s artistry in every icicle and snowflake.

Nainital: A Winter Tale by the Lake

Embraced by the Kumaon Hills, Nainital transforms into a winter fairy tale. The Naini Lake, surrounded by snow-capped hills, reflects the winter sky like a mirror. The Snow View Point, accessible by a cable car, offers a breathtaking panorama of the snow-draped peaks, making it a must-visit during the winter months.

Packing Essentials for a Winter Expedition

Given the chilly weather, it’s essential to pack wisely. Ensure you bring layers, thermal wear, and waterproof boots to navigate through the snowy terrains comfortably. Don’t forget your camera to capture the breathtaking moments that Himachal Pradesh and Uttarakhand offer during the winter season.
